El Caballo ""Cuarto de milla (americano)"" proviene originalmente de los Estados Unidos y es la raza más extendida del mundo. A nivel mundial hay aproximadamente 4,6 millones de caballos registrados.La raza surgió en el siglo XVII, cuando plantadores ricos de Virginia y Carolina decidieron criar un ... Annie Oakley Roan Mare • 4 Years Old • 15 Hands Annie Oakley is what happens when natural beauty, good training, and a standout mind all land in the same horse. She is talented, genuine, and enjoyable in a way that is immediately apparent — a mare that feels good to sit on, easy to understand, and rewarding to ride. Her rich roan coat, frosted mane and tail, and balanced build make her eye-catching, but her real value shows up when you swing a leg over. For a four-year-old, Annie Oakley is remarkably broke and educated. She rides soft, stays correct through her body, and carries herself with purpose. She bends and shapes willingly, lopes around with a smooth, easy rhythm, and offers a nice sliding stop and a stylish turnaround. She feels steady, confident, and far along for her age. Annie Oakley has a good head on her shoulders. She is gentle, kind, and honest, with a natural desire to do right by her rider. She is safe for a variety of rider levels and adjusts easily to who is in the saddle. She meets you at the gate, drops her head for the bridle, and goes to work with a willing attitude. She is the kind that makes riding simple and enjoyable. She has been tracking cattle, shows a lot of interest, and has already been gathering. Annie Oakley displays plenty of natural cow sense and feels like a mare that will continue to excel with cattle work as she goes forward. She is well exposed and seasoned beyond her years. Bridges, tarps, pool noodles, and obstacle courses are all handled quietly. New places and new tasks are met with curiosity and composure. Out on the trail, Annie Oakley is steady and sure-footed. She travels through hills, crosses water, and handles wildlife and changing scenery with ease. She is just as enjoyable outside the arena as she is inside it. She is good in traffic, stands tied quietly, clips easily, is good for the farrier, hauls well, and does well in both a stall and pasture. Annie Oakley is the kind that earns her keep. The kind that gets ridden first. The kind you build a program around. A truly special young mare with a bright future ahead of her.
